Choosing the right bidding strategy is key to your manufacturing PPC campaign:
For manufacturers focused on website traffic consider the cost-per-click (CPC) bidding strategy. Determine the maximum amount you’re willing to pay per click based on the value of a new visitor to your business. Consider brand awareness, engagement, average conversion rate and customer lifetime value (CLV).
Alternatively use the “Maximize Clicks” Smart Bidding strategy by setting an average daily budget and let Google handle the bidding.
